Comprehending the IELTS Test Structure
Before starting a preparation journey, it is vital to acquaint oneself with the exam's format. IELTS consists of 4 modules: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. The Academic version is generally needed for university admission, while the General Training version is used for immigration and workplace functions.
ModuleVariety of QuestionsPeriodMaterial FocusListening40Thirty minutes (plus 10 minutes to move answers)Conversations and monologues in daily social contextsReading4060 minutesThree long texts (Academic) or much shorter passages (General Training)Writing2 tasks60 minutesJob 1: describe visual details (Academic) or compose a letter (General Training); Task 2: essaySpeaking3 parts11-- 14 minutesIntro, cue card discussion, and follow‑up concerns
Understanding the timing and question types is the initial step towards a "guaranteed" result, as it enables prospects to designate study time efficiently.
A Step‑by‑Step Plan to Secure Your IELTS Certificate
Below is a systematic approach that, when abided by, maximises the likelihood of attaining the wanted band rating.

Examine Your Current Level
Take a main practice test or a reliable online diagnostic to identify your standard band. Recognize strengths and weak points across the 4 modules.
Set a Realistic Target Band
Verify the minimum rating needed by your university, immigration program, or company. Select a target that is one band higher than the minimum to create a safety margin.
Produce a Study Schedule
Designate 6-- 8 weeks for extensive preparation (longer if your standard is far from the target). Devote daily blocks: e.g., 1 hour Listening, 1 hour Reading, 1.5 hours Writing, and 30 minutes Speaking.
Usage Official Materials
IELTS.org offers complimentary sample tests and band‑score descriptors. The Cambridge IELTS series (Books 17-- 19) provides genuine past papers. Official apps (e.g., IELTS Liz, British Council's "TakeIELTS") consist of timed practice.
Practice Under Test Conditions
Mimic the exam environment: rigorous timing, no breaks, and a peaceful area. After each full‑length practice test, evaluation responses thoroughly and note repeating mistakes.
Look For Professional Feedback
Enrol in a trustworthy preparation course (e.g., IDP, British Council, or a licensed local language school). Use experienced tutors for composing and speaking evaluations; their targeted remarks are vital.
Develop Test‑Day Strategies
Listening: Read ahead, expect signal words, and transfer responses promptly. Checking out: Skim passages for essences, then scan for information. Writing: Spend the first 5 minutes planning both tasks; comply with the word count (minimum 150 for Task 1, 250 for Task 2). Speaking: Maintain eye contact, respond to each question completely, and use a variety of grammatical structures.Recommended Resources

Typical Pitfalls and How to Avoid ThemPoor Time Management-- Many prospects run out of time in Reading and Writing. Experiment a timer and find out to skip tough questions briefly. Overlooking Speaking Practice-- Speaking is typically the least practiced module. Set up a minimum of three mock interviews with a partner or tutor before the exam. Depending on "Brain Dumps"-- Some sites declare to provide "ensured" questions. These are undependable and may breach test security policies. Focus on genuine ability development rather. Neglecting Band Descriptors-- Understanding the assessment requirements (Task Response, Coherence & & Cohesion, Lexical Resource, Grammatical Range) helps candidates target particular improvement areas.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
